History
The University of Calcutta was founded on January 24, 1857, marking a significant milestone in India's educational landscape. It was the first university in India to be established as a result of the British colonial administration's efforts to promote higher education. Initially modeled after the University of London, it began with a handful of faculties and a few hundred students. Over the years, the university expanded its academic offerings and infrastructure, adapting to the changing educational needs of society. Significant milestones include the introduction of women's education in the late 19th century and the establishment of various research centers. The university has played a crucial role in India's social and political movements, fostering leaders and thinkers who have contributed to the nation's progress. Today, it stands as a symbol of academic resilience and growth, continuously evolving to meet the demands of modern education.

Cost & Finance
Estimated Cost (INR)
The estimated yearly cost ranges from INR 50,000 to INR 150,000.
Tuition Fees
Tuition fees at the University of Calcutta vary depending on the program level and discipline. Undergraduate programs typically range from INR 10,000 to INR 30,000 per year, while postgraduate programs can cost between INR 15,000 and INR 50,000 annually. Research programs may have different fee structures based on the specific requirements of the faculty and research centers. International students should also be aware that fees for them might be higher compared to domestic students, but the overall cost of studying in India remains competitive. Financial aid and scholarships are available to assist with these expenses, making education more affordable.
Housing & Living Costs
Living costs in Kolkata are relatively affordable compared to other major cities in India. On average, students can expect to spend between INR 10,000 to INR 20,000 per month on accommodation, food, transportation, and other essentials. Renting a room or sharing an apartment in student accommodations offers reasonable options. Local transportation is budget-friendly, with various public transit systems available. Eating at local restaurants and markets can help manage food costs effectively. Overall, students can maintain a comfortable lifestyle while studying at the University of Calcutta without incurring excessive expenses.

Accreditation & Recognition
The University of Calcutta is recognized by various accreditation bodies, ensuring that it meets high standards of education and institutional effectiveness. It is affiliated with the University Grants Commission (UGC) of India, which oversees higher education institutions in the country. Additionally, the university has received accreditation from the National Assessment and Accreditation Council (NAAC), reflecting its commitment to quality and excellence in education. These recognitions not only validate the university's academic programs but also enhance its reputation among students looking to study in India. The university’s adherence to these standards ensures that students receive a quality education that is respected both nationally and internationally, facilitating their transition into global careers.
